Gotchas & Edge Cases
Ethical Design: Caps, Transparency, No Pay-to-Play
Variable-ratio reinforcement is a powerful engagement mechanic. The templates enforce ethical boundaries:
- Daily and weekly caps prevent compulsive over-engagement. Default: 1 daily spin + 2 random bonuses per day, 10 total per week.
- Probability transparency —
RewardPool exposes its rarity weights so you can display them in a "Reward Rates" info sheet (required by some App Store regions).
- No pay-to-play — the templates do not gate rewards behind purchases. If you add premium reward tiers, keep a generous free tier and clearly label paid content.
- Cooldown timers show users exactly when the next reward is available rather than encouraging constant app-checking.
Server Time vs Device Time for Daily Resets
Users can change their device clock to claim extra rewards. Mitigations:
- For local-only apps, use
Date() with Calendar.current.startOfDay(for:) — accept that determined users can game it.
- For server-synced apps, fetch the current time from your server on each claim and validate server-side. The templates include a
timeProvider protocol for injecting server time.
- Store raw
Date timestamps alongside normalized day values so you can detect anomalies (claims with createdAt before a previously recorded claim).
Deterministic Testing of Random Outcomes
RewardPool accepts a seed parameter that initializes the random number generator deterministically. In tests, always pass a fixed seed so assertions are stable:
let pool = RewardPool(seed: 42)
let reward = pool.drawReward()
In production, omit the seed to use system entropy.
Rarity Weight Tuning
The default rarity weights (common: 60%, uncommon: 25%, rare: 10%, epic: 5%) produce one epic reward roughly every 20 claims. Adjust weights in RewardPool.defaultWeights to match your engagement goals. Verify with a histogram test:
@Test
func rarityDistributionMatchesWeights() {
let pool = RewardPool(seed: 0)
var counts: [Reward.Rarity: Int] = [:]
for _ in 0..<10_000 {
let reward = pool.drawReward()
counts[reward.rarity, default: 0] += 1
}
#expect(counts[.epic]! > 300 && counts[.epic]! < 700)
}
App Reinstall / Data Loss
SwiftData stores persist across app updates but are lost on reinstall. For valuable reward inventories, sync to CloudKit or a backend. The RewardManager includes a lastSyncDate hook for this purpose.
Midnight Reset Race Condition
If a user claims a reward at 11:59:59 PM and the daily reset fires at midnight, ensure the claim is attributed to the correct day. The templates use Calendar.current.startOfDay(for: claimDate) to normalize all claims to their calendar day, avoiding off-by-one errors at the boundary.
App Store Guidelines
- Guideline 3.1.1: If randomized rewards can be purchased (paid spins, mystery boxes bought via IAP or a paid currency), Apple requires disclosing the odds of receiving each item type before purchase — the loot-box rule. Free daily spins with no paid entry point are exempt.
- Guideline 4.5.4: "Your daily spin is ready" pushes are promotional notifications — allowed only with explicit opt-in consent shown in your UI and an in-app opt-out, not just the system permission prompt.
- Age rating: Slot-style spins and near-miss animations can read as simulated gambling and force a higher age rating. Keep the presentation clearly non-monetary if your rating assumes otherwise.
- Guideline 4.3 (Spam): Reward mechanics layered onto a thin app don't create distinctness. If this is one of several similar apps on your account, run
app-store/originality-check before submitting.
